AdBlue Unveiled: Supply Chains & Manufacturing Secrets
AdBlue is an essential component in reducing harmful emissions produced by diesel engines. This aqueous urea solution is injected into the exhaust system of diesel vehicles to convert nitrogen oxides (NOx) into harmless nitrogen and water vapor, contributing significantly to cleaner air and improved environmental standards.

AdBlue Manufacturing: A Closer Look
The Process Behind Production
AdBlue manufacturing involves a precise chemical process that ensures the final product meets the required specifications. Understanding how AdBlue is produced can help users appreciate its quality and effectiveness.
Key Steps in AdBlue Manufacturing
Raw Materials: AdBlue primarily consists of urea and deionized water, sourced from reputable suppliers to ensure quality.
Synthesis Process: The manufacturing process involves dissolving high-purity urea in water to achieve the 32.5% concentration required for AdBlue.
Quality Control: Rigorous testing is conducted to confirm that the product meets the ISO 22241 standards, which stipulate the purity requirements for AdBlue.
Packaging: AdBlue is packaged in various forms, including drums, IBCs, and bulk tankers, to cater to different customer needs.
Storage Conditions: Proper storage conditions are essential to maintain the integrity of AdBlue. It should be kept in a cool place away from sunlight.
